What is transport and logistics?

Transport and logistics are the processes and procedures for getting goods from the point of origin to the point of consumption. Transport is the physical movement of goods whereas logistics is the planning, processes, and procedures controlling the movement of goods.  

What is logistics and transport management?

Transport and logistics management is the coordination of an organization's inbound and outbound freight movements, both internally and externally.

What risks are important to consider for logistics and transportation?

 There are many risks associated with the transport and logistics of goods. The risk the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A) consider are:

  • Unsafe driving
  • HoS Compliance
  • Driver fitness & controlled substance abuse
  • Vehicle maintenance
  • Collision detection

This insurance risk however just scratches of the risks that must be managed. Other transportation and logistics risks include:

  • Carrier delays and non-performance.
  • Hijacking and theft.
  • Liability for loss or delays.
  • New security and safety legislation.
  • Cybersecurity. 
  • Driver shortages. 
  • Deteriorating infrastructure. 
  • Greater regulatory oversight. 
  • Financial stability.
